Output 332f4e2c71679d996fb9a4e066f33684e16cdc565b1ec5233b98ab2b589d64ca:0

value
3149435886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b35806255f19272c32ab67126e7a119162a9ed1 OP_EQUAL
address
34AtG5AUTDzvvbigj8Uh46avZseRagEpbu
transaction
332f4e2c71679d996fb9a4e066f33684e16cdc565b1ec5233b98ab2b589d64ca
spent
true